A couch is an extremely sturdy piece of furniture. It will be used by families through movie marathons and board games. It will also be used for naps, spills, and a myriad of other things. It needs to be strong enough to stand up to wear and tear. This is why you should choose a couch with a solid frame. Hammett recommends looking for a frame made of wood, because it lasts longer than plywood or medium-density fiberboard (MDF).
Another important aspect is the structure of your sofa's cushions. You may not be in a position of examining the interior of a couch, but he recommends that you look for a mix of foam and down. "This will give the sofa a cozy feeling of sinking in and will also give it support," he says. A sofa without a foam core, on the other hand, will likely sag over time.

A solid frame is vital for a sofa to last for a long period of time and be reasonably priced. It will keep your couch looking good and prevent it from becoming sagging with time. Choose options made of hardwood and metal to ensure the durability of your investment.
Look in stores like Target, Bed Bath & Beyond and Home Depot to find affordable quality couches. You can also get bargains on sofas by shopping sales, like Black Friday and Cyber Monday. If you're willing to hold off you can also find discounted furniture during the spring and fall seasons.
There are several factors to consider when shopping for an affordable and comfortable sofa such as the fabric of the couch and its color frame material, as well as armrests. Select from cotton, polyester and velvet. Synthetic fabrics are less expensive than natural fibers, and are also more easy to clean.
